Lancaster Society 19 sews at Osteopathic Hospital from 9 a.m. to 3 p.m. Master Gardeners Master Gardeners are working in your com munity. Depending on the daily requests we receive at the Extension Office, Master Gar deners will assist with special gardening projects. These projects could include a large nursing home garden planting or help with a backyard city-type garden. They will assist with garden club demonstrations or presentations or youth programs with the public schools, scouts and 4-H. Master Gardeners are teachers, ad ministrators, housewi ves and retired in dividuals. Without a doubt, York County residents will find the Master Gardener program a real valuable and informative service to the community. For more information on how you can become a Master Gardener in York County, contact the Extension Office at 757-9657. W^JOTUL' BOWMAN'S STOVE SHOP RD 3, Ephrata, PA 17522 Rt. 322,1 Mi. Past presidents Betty Saylor, Hazel Stauffer, Opal Ruhl and Naomi Spahr talked about the club’s earlier years. New officers to be installed at the county convention are: Connne Nissley, vice president; Bernice Miller, treasurer and Rodella Weaver, corresponding secretary. State convention delegates in clude: Lavma Musser, Wilma Slaymaker and Naomi Spahr, alternate. For their next meeting, mem bers will sew at the Lancaster Community Hospital on Oct. 20. The group then traveled to the home of Irene Rentzel for the business meeting. Ten members of the York Society will attend the County Convention to be held at Wisehaven on Nov. 6. Results of the election of officers are as follows: Nancy Emswiler, treasurer; Phyllis Bear, assistant treasurer; Helen Bentz, secretary and Donna Hoover, assistant secretary. The Society also celebrated Beatrice Hemdel and Gladys Gladfelter’s birthdays. The next meeting will be a Thanksgiving dinner on Nov. 12 at 6 p.m., at the home Irene Rentzel. Smoketown, Pa Lancaster Soci f *y 25 Lancaster Society 25 met on Oct. 11 at the home of Emma Goss, Millersville with 18 members in attendance. Phyllis Reapsome led in devotions and Ben Kreider, a guitarist from Quarryville, en tertained with poems and songs The group gave 39 hours of service to the Heart Association and they made bed pads and ditty bags for the Cancer Society.
